Re: rsb gdb build on aarch64 (OS-X M2)
On 28/9/2023 6:28 am, Heinz Junkes wrote: > It was a mess with homebrew and python versions on my system. > Rsb works well ;-) Thanks for following this up and good to know. Have you managed to use the gdb executable? A user has reported on discord the ARM gdb crashing however I do not see that happening with my build. I build on my M2 using a python.org install, a virtual environment and X code. I welcome users using homebrew or macports but I cannot directly support the efforts because of the amount of work to that would be more than I can handle. Chris ___ users mailing list users@rtems.org http://lists.rtems.org/mailman/listinfo/users
Re: rsb gdb build on aarch64 (OS-X M2)
It was a mess with homebrew and python versions on my system. Rsb works well ;-) Heinz > On 27. Sep 2023, at 20:26, Heinz Junkes wrote: > > Hallo, > > I'm trying to build RTEMS on a MAC (M2) and I'm getting the following error: > > > config: tools/rtems-gdb-13.2.cfg > error: config error: gdb-common-1.cfg:127: "gdb: python: library file not > found: libpython3.11.*, please install" > Build FAILED > Build Set: Time 0:02:09.754310 > error: config error: gdb-common-1.cfg:127: "gdb: python: library file not > found: libpython3.11.*, please install" > Build Set: Time 0:02:09.758390 > Build FAILED > building failed > > > Danke Heinz > > Complete output: > > ... building tool set for arm > RTEMS Source Builder - Set Builder, 6 (35c73203df1e) > Build Set: 6/rtems-arm > Build Set: tools/rtems-default-tools.bset > config: devel/dtc-1.6.1-1.cfg > package: dtc-1.6.1-arm64-apple-darwin23.0.0-1 > Creating source directory: sources > download: https://www.kernel.org/pub/software/utils/dtc/dtc-1.6.1.tar.gz -> > sources/dtc-1.6.1.tar.gz > redirect: > https://mirrors.edge.kernel.org/pub/software/utils/dtc/dtc-1.6.1.tar.gz > downloading: sources/dtc-1.6.1.tar.gz - 199.0kB of 199.0kB (100%) > Creating source directory: patches > download: > https://devel.rtems.org/raw-attachment/ticket/4783/0001-checks.c-Ensure-argument-is-an... log> -> patches/0001-checks.c-Ensure-argument-is-an-integer-v2.patch > downloading: patches/0001-checks.c-Ensure-argument-is-an-integer-v2.patch - > 773.0 bytes of 773.0 bytes (100%) > building: dtc-1.6.1-arm64-apple-darwin23.0.0-1 > sizes: dtc-1.6.1-arm64-apple-darwin23.0.0-1: 3.038MB (installed: 712.910KB) > cleaning: dtc-1.6.1-arm64-apple-darwin23.0.0-1 > reporting: devel/dtc-1.6.1-1.cfg -> dtc-1.6.1-arm64-apple-darwin23.0.0-1.txt > reporting: devel/dtc-1.6.1-1.cfg -> dtc-1.6.1-arm64-apple-darwin23.0.0-1.xml > config: devel/expat-2.5.0-1.cfg > package: expat-2.5.0-arm64-apple-darwin23.0.0-1 > download: > https://github.com/libexpat/libexpat/releases/download/R_2_5_0/expat-2.5.0.tar.gz > -> sources/expat-2.5.0.tar.gz > redirect: > https://objects.githubusercontent.com/github-production-release-asset-2e65be/80314213/... log> > downloading: sources/expat-2.5.0.tar.gz - 702.4kB of 702.4kB (100%) > building: expat-2.5.0-arm64-apple-darwin23.0.0-1 > sizes: expat-2.5.0-arm64-apple-darwin23.0.0-1: 7.537MB (installed: 886.030KB) > cleaning: expat-2.5.0-arm64-apple-darwin23.0.0-1 > reporting: devel/expat-2.5.0-1.cfg -> > expat-2.5.0-arm64-apple-darwin23.0.0-1.txt > reporting: devel/expat-2.5.0-1.cfg -> > expat-2.5.0-arm64-apple-darwin23.0.0-1.xml > config: devel/gmp-6.2.1.cfg > package: gmp-6.2.1-arm64-apple-darwin23.0.0-1 > download: https://gcc.gnu.org/pub/gcc/infrastructure/gmp-6.2.1.tar.bz2 -> > sources/gmp-6.2.1.tar.bz2 > downloading: sources/gmp-6.2.1.tar.bz2 - 2.4MB of 2.4MB (100%) > building: gmp-6.2.1-arm64-apple-darwin23.0.0-1 > sizes: gmp-6.2.1-arm64-apple-darwin23.0.0-1: 21.584MB (installed: 1.428MB) > cleaning: gmp-6.2.1-arm64-apple-darwin23.0.0-1 > reporting: devel/gmp-6.2.1.cfg -> gmp-6.2.1-arm64-apple-darwin23.0.0-1.txt > reporting: devel/gmp-6.2.1.cfg -> gmp-6.2.1-arm64-apple-darwin23.0.0-1.xml > Build Set: textproc/gsed-internal.bset > config: textproc/gsed.cfg > package: gsed-4.9-arm64-apple-darwin23.0.0-1 > download: https://ftp.gnu.org/gnu/sed/sed-4.9.tar.gz -> sources/sed-4.9.tar.gz > downloading: sources/sed-4.9.tar.gz - 2.2MB of 2.2MB (100%) > building: gsed-4.9-arm64-apple-darwin23.0.0-1 > sizes: gsed-4.9-arm64-apple-darwin23.0.0-1: 18.014MB (installed: 0.000B) > cleaning: gsed-4.9-arm64-apple-darwin23.0.0-1 > cleaning: gsed-4.9-arm64-apple-darwin23.0.0-1 > Build Set: Time 0:00:41.529142 > Build Set: print/texinfo-internal.bset > config: print/texinfo.cfg > package: texinfo-7.0.3-arm64-apple-darwin23.0.0-1 > download: https://ftp.gnu.org/gnu/texinfo/texinfo-7.0.3.tar.gz -> > sources/texinfo-7.0.3.tar.gz > downloading: sources/texinfo-7.0.3.tar.gz - 10.3MB of 10.3MB (100%) > building: texinfo-7.0.3-arm64-apple-darwin23.0.0-1 > sizes: texinfo-7.0.3-arm64-apple-darwin23.0.0-1: 88.097MB (installed: 0.000B) > cleaning: texinfo-7.0.3-arm64-apple-darwin23.0.0-1 > cleaning: texinfo-7.0.3-arm64-apple-darwin23.0.0-1 > Build Set: Time 0:00:49.355165 > config: tools/rtems-gdb-13.2.cfg > error: config error: gdb-common-1.cfg:127: "gdb: python: library file not > found: libpython3.11.*, please install" > Build FAILED > Build Set: Time 0:02:09.754310 > error: config error: gdb-common-1.cfg:127: "gdb: python: library file not > found: libpython3.11.*, please install" > Build Set: Time 0:02:09.758390 > Build FAILED > building failed___ > users mailing list > users@rtems.org > http://lists.rtems.org/mailman/listinfo/users smime.p7s Description: S/MIME cryptographic signature ___ users mailing list users@rtems.org http://lists.rtems.org/mailman/listinfo/users
rsb gdb build on aarch64 (OS-X M2)
Hallo, I'm trying to build RTEMS on a MAC (M2) and I'm getting the following error: config: tools/rtems-gdb-13.2.cfg error: config error: gdb-common-1.cfg:127: "gdb: python: library file not found: libpython3.11.*, please install" Build FAILED Build Set: Time 0:02:09.754310 error: config error: gdb-common-1.cfg:127: "gdb: python: library file not found: libpython3.11.*, please install" Build Set: Time 0:02:09.758390 Build FAILED building failed Danke Heinz Complete output: ... building tool set for arm RTEMS Source Builder - Set Builder, 6 (35c73203df1e) Build Set: 6/rtems-arm Build Set: tools/rtems-default-tools.bset config: devel/dtc-1.6.1-1.cfg package: dtc-1.6.1-arm64-apple-darwin23.0.0-1 Creating source directory: sources download: https://www.kernel.org/pub/software/utils/dtc/dtc-1.6.1.tar.gz -> sources/dtc-1.6.1.tar.gz redirect: https://mirrors.edge.kernel.org/pub/software/utils/dtc/dtc-1.6.1.tar.gz downloading: sources/dtc-1.6.1.tar.gz - 199.0kB of 199.0kB (100%) Creating source directory: patches download: https://devel.rtems.org/raw-attachment/ticket/4783/0001-checks.c-Ensure-argument-is-an... -> patches/0001-checks.c-Ensure-argument-is-an-integer-v2.patch downloading: patches/0001-checks.c-Ensure-argument-is-an-integer-v2.patch - 773.0 bytes of 773.0 bytes (100%) building: dtc-1.6.1-arm64-apple-darwin23.0.0-1 sizes: dtc-1.6.1-arm64-apple-darwin23.0.0-1: 3.038MB (installed: 712.910KB) cleaning: dtc-1.6.1-arm64-apple-darwin23.0.0-1 reporting: devel/dtc-1.6.1-1.cfg -> dtc-1.6.1-arm64-apple-darwin23.0.0-1.txt reporting: devel/dtc-1.6.1-1.cfg -> dtc-1.6.1-arm64-apple-darwin23.0.0-1.xml config: devel/expat-2.5.0-1.cfg package: expat-2.5.0-arm64-apple-darwin23.0.0-1 download: https://github.com/libexpat/libexpat/releases/download/R_2_5_0/expat-2.5.0.tar.gz -> sources/expat-2.5.0.tar.gz redirect: https://objects.githubusercontent.com/github-production-release-asset-2e65be/80314213/... downloading: sources/expat-2.5.0.tar.gz - 702.4kB of 702.4kB (100%) building: expat-2.5.0-arm64-apple-darwin23.0.0-1 sizes: expat-2.5.0-arm64-apple-darwin23.0.0-1: 7.537MB (installed: 886.030KB) cleaning: expat-2.5.0-arm64-apple-darwin23.0.0-1 reporting: devel/expat-2.5.0-1.cfg -> expat-2.5.0-arm64-apple-darwin23.0.0-1.txt reporting: devel/expat-2.5.0-1.cfg -> expat-2.5.0-arm64-apple-darwin23.0.0-1.xml config: devel/gmp-6.2.1.cfg package: gmp-6.2.1-arm64-apple-darwin23.0.0-1 download: https://gcc.gnu.org/pub/gcc/infrastructure/gmp-6.2.1.tar.bz2 -> sources/gmp-6.2.1.tar.bz2 downloading: sources/gmp-6.2.1.tar.bz2 - 2.4MB of 2.4MB (100%) building: gmp-6.2.1-arm64-apple-darwin23.0.0-1 sizes: gmp-6.2.1-arm64-apple-darwin23.0.0-1: 21.584MB (installed: 1.428MB) cleaning: gmp-6.2.1-arm64-apple-darwin23.0.0-1 reporting: devel/gmp-6.2.1.cfg -> gmp-6.2.1-arm64-apple-darwin23.0.0-1.txt reporting: devel/gmp-6.2.1.cfg -> gmp-6.2.1-arm64-apple-darwin23.0.0-1.xml Build Set: textproc/gsed-internal.bset config: textproc/gsed.cfg package: gsed-4.9-arm64-apple-darwin23.0.0-1 download: https://ftp.gnu.org/gnu/sed/sed-4.9.tar.gz -> sources/sed-4.9.tar.gz downloading: sources/sed-4.9.tar.gz - 2.2MB of 2.2MB (100%) building: gsed-4.9-arm64-apple-darwin23.0.0-1 sizes: gsed-4.9-arm64-apple-darwin23.0.0-1: 18.014MB (installed: 0.000B) cleaning: gsed-4.9-arm64-apple-darwin23.0.0-1 cleaning: gsed-4.9-arm64-apple-darwin23.0.0-1 Build Set: Time 0:00:41.529142 Build Set: print/texinfo-internal.bset config: print/texinfo.cfg package: texinfo-7.0.3-arm64-apple-darwin23.0.0-1 download: https://ftp.gnu.org/gnu/texinfo/texinfo-7.0.3.tar.gz -> sources/texinfo-7.0.3.tar.gz downloading: sources/texinfo-7.0.3.tar.gz - 10.3MB of 10.3MB (100%) building: texinfo-7.0.3-arm64-apple-darwin23.0.0-1 sizes: texinfo-7.0.3-arm64-apple-darwin23.0.0-1: 88.097MB (installed: 0.000B) cleaning: texinfo-7.0.3-arm64-apple-darwin23.0.0-1 cleaning: texinfo-7.0.3-arm64-apple-darwin23.0.0-1 Build Set: Time 0:00:49.355165 config: tools/rtems-gdb-13.2.cfg error: config error: gdb-common-1.cfg:127: "gdb: python: library file not found: libpython3.11.*, please install" Build FAILED Build Set: Time 0:02:09.754310 error: config error: gdb-common-1.cfg:127: "gdb: python: library file not found: libpython3.11.*, please install" Build Set: Time 0:02:09.758390 Build FAILED building failed smime.p7s Description: S/MIME cryptographic signature ___ users mailing list users@rtems.org http://lists.rtems.org/mailman/listinfo/users